Chili Dip Recipe

Here's a meaty chili dip recipe with canned chili without beans, ground beef, cheese, and seasonings. Serve this dip with tortilla chips or your favorite corn chips.

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up chopped onion
  • 1 to 1 1/2 pounds lean ground beef
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 can (16 ounces) chili without beans
  • 16 ounces grated process American cheese (Velveeta)
  • salt, to taste

Preparation:

Brown ground beef in a large skillet; add onion and cook until onion is tender, but not browned. Pour off excess fat. Add cumin, chili powder, chili, and cheese; cook, stirring occasionally, until cheese is melted. Taste and add salt, as needed. Serve in slow cooker or chafing dish with tortilla chips or crackers.
